Transaction 50dfb6c30af9aa90fc7306699adab84b18332f401464857c9a6b05f9149448b7
1 Input
1 Output
-
50dfb6c30af9aa90fc7306699adab84b18332f401464857c9a6b05f9149448b7:0
- value
- 495130
- script pubkey
- OP_0 OP_PUSHBYTES_20 f77bdafe7381a136fea41b75726662b3f7762270
- address
- bc1q7aaa4lnnsxsndl4yrd6hyenzk0mhvgnsk75wyj